Kadesh

Kadesh or Qadesh (in classical Hebrew Hebrew: קָדֵשׁ‬, from the root קדש‬ "holy") is a place-name that occurs several times in the Hebrew Bible, describing a site or sites located south of, or at the southern border of, Canaan and the Kingdom of Judah.

Meaning: Holiness Origin: Israeli

Kanah

Kanah. From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Kanah (ka'-na: Ishish.Manish.reedy; brook of reeds) is a stream referred to in the Hebrew Bible forming the boundary between Ephraim and Manasseh, from the Mediterranean Sea eastward to Tappuah (Joshua 16:8).

Meaning: Of reeds Origin: Israeli
